Forget everything you thought you knew about Yellowstone’s future. The years-long news cycle about rumored spin-offs, Matthew McConaughey–led sequels, and Kevin Costner’s potential return in season 5?

That’s all over now. Costner’s character, John Dutton, is dead. In season 5’s midseason premiere, creator Taylor Sheridan promptly threw the fate of the Dutton family into chaos.

With just five more episodes left before the season—and maybe the series—ends, anything is possible.

Reportedly, season 6 is even on the table. According to a report from Puck’s Matthew Belloni, Paramount is considering keeping the flagship series going despite billing season 5 as the final one.

Variety confirmed the story, including new information that fan favorites Kelly Reilly (Beth Dutton) and Cole Hauser (Rip Wheeler) are currently in talks to return.

yellowstone

Paramount has yet to comment on the rumors. Earlier this fall, the network announced a sequel series titled The Madison, starring Michelle Pfeiffer and Lost’s Matthew Fox as members of a new family, the Clyburns.

That news had already opened a can of worms regarding Yellowstone’s future—namely, who the hell are the Clyburns?

Will Yellowstone Season 6 With Rip & Beth Happen? Yellowstone Can Now Continue Freely After John’s Death

Aside from the string of prequels that will continue, Sheridan is also launching a couple of Yellowstone spinoffs set in the modern day.

That includes the previously-reported 6666 offshoot and the recently-announced The Madison starring Michelle Pfeiffer, Matthew Fox, and Patrick J. Adams.

When the aforementioned shows will debut is still unknown at this point, which makes sense, considering that Sheridan’s focus is on finishing Yellowstone season 5 by declaring the winner between Beth and Jamie’s ongoing feud.

That said, if “All You Need Is Desire” is any indication, a Rip and Beth-led Yellowstone show is very possible. The Neo-Western series is a massive hit, and while there are offshoots that can continue its legacy if it wraps up its run, nothing can still compare to the success of the flagship show.

With Costner’s time effectively finished, Sheridan can move the project forward in a different direction, as it ushers a new generation of Duttons at its forefront. Aside from Rip and Beth, Kayce, Monica, and Carter can round up the revamped ensemble.
